Review of Stories We Tell (2012) by Colin Covert for Minneapolis Star Tribune — 29 May 2013
It's a relationship drama spanning three decades, a detective mystery, an essay on the nature of memory, and a critique of our need to process messy human life into streamlined narrative arcs even at the cost of oversimplifying.
